Course Description

Practicing Effective Management provides managers with relevant guideline and meaningful tools for workplace success.  In this training, participants will understand the nuances of management vs. leadership, identify appropriate ways to support their staff through structured supervision, learn how to exercise effective time management, and effectively respond to the demands of a competitive work environment.

Through course materials and active teaching methods, participants are equipped with the information and tools needed to develop and maintain successful, strengths-based, professional relationships with their peers and staff while maintaining good boundaries between their job demands and personal life.  Key aspects of this training are relevant to all levels and types of management, including new managers, practice managers, executives, and experienced professionals.
